Plumule of Seed
The plumule is the part of the embryonic structure found within the seed of a plant. It is a bud-like structure that serves as the precursor to the shoot system of the plant. The plumule in plants consists of the embryonic shoot apex, which contains meristematic tissue capable of giving rise to the plant’s stem, leaves, and other aerial parts.
